In 2006 Chris went on a life changing trip working through Relief Riders International. He spent a couple of weeks on horseback traveling through remote, low income villages in India handing out educational materials to underserved schools, working through the Give A Goat program to donate livestock to low income communities, and setting up medical camps to provide dental, eye, and obstetrics care to populations lacking healthcare.

For now, what we can tell you is the activities they will participate will include up to the following:
100 free Cataract surgeries
400 Dental screenings & Treatments
12 Goats for Widows and Below Poverty Level families or individuals.
6 months of educational supplies for 1200 children (Pens, pencils, crayons, pencils cases, drawing pads, notebooks, rulers, erasers and sharpeners)
Sporting equipment and Brain games for 3 schools (Each school receives 2 Cricket sets, 2 Volley balls and net, 4 soccer balls with cones, 20 tennis balls, 4 Badminton Racquets, net and box of Shuttlecocks, a carom board)
